The British Airways flight carrying medical supplies for Antigua and Barbuda arrived at the V.C Bird International Airport on Saturday.
This donation, valued at EC$4 million, comes from the Calvin Ayre Foundation.
The contents, which include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) such as masks, surgical gowns and thermometers were handed over to Permanent Secretary within the Ministry of Health, Wellness and the Environment, Ena Dalso Henry.
